If you get a message window trying to launch 3DC that says, "Application error", "Problem checking Steam application." you must exit your Steam software and re-launch Steam as an Administrator to resolve this error.

I think what ScrotieFlapWack (love the name) is saying, is that every game/program/video that you launch on Steam will change your status to a sort of "actively doing this thing". ie, if you run Portal 2, it will show you as playing Portal 2. This also tracks the hours that you've been using things. 

In the case of 3dc, it does not recognise that you are using it, nor does it track the time you've spent in it. (I've been on 311 hours for a few months now, so it was working at some point, but I don't remember when it stopped working)

It doesn't actually stop you from using the software, so I can understand this being a low priority issue. It's just an annoying little thing, plus it used to work just fine, so something's gone wrong.

Yeah, as Gary Dave said when loading 3D - Coat up through my Steam library it doesn't seem to track me using it. When I load up 3D - Coat my status on Steam changes to using 3D - Coat for about 2 seconds and then puts me back online. This is a tad bit annoying because I'll be working in 3D - Coat and my friends will be asking me to join a game with them because my status shows me as 'Online' and not in 3D - Coat.

Also Gary is right, it doesn't track your hours at all. I think this issue has been raised before (by before I mean about 2 years ago) and it never got fixed. I really hope this get's fixed, it's such a small problem and seems to be something that (probably) can be easily fixed.
